WebMay 9, 2024 · Apply Vinegar Water Mixture To The Carpet. To remove mildew and musty smells, apply a mixture of vinegar and water to the affected area of the carpet. Vinegar is a great home remedy for absorbing stubborn odors. Depending on the amount of mildew on the carpet, mix one cup of white vinegar for every two cups of water.
